Local history

50 years ago: May 17, 1974

The Interstate Commerce Commission held hearings at Roosevelt Junior High on the future of Norfolk Southern/CSX Railroads, which had purchased Conrail. Gov. Milton Shapp and U.S. Rep. Bud Shuster both testified.

25 years ago: May 17, 1999

The Faith Baptist Church in Altoona, The Rev. Gary G. Dull pastor, was lobbying the Altoona Area School Board to post a copy of the Ten Commandments in each of the district's schools, called "Project Ten Commandments."

10 years ago: May 17, 2014

The Central Blair Recreation and Park Commission and the Booker T. Washington Community Revitalization Committee were combining to build a new play park for kids at Memorial Park in Juniata and at Prospect Park in Altoona, supervised by a company called Playtime.
